In a study published on Thursday 17 October, Toy Industries of Europe (TIE), the trade association for the European toy industry, expressed alarm at the lack of conformity of toys from online trading platforms.
According to the results obtained on a hundred or so unbranded or unknown-brand products, “80% of toys purchased from third-party traders on online marketplaces do not comply with EU safety standards and could pose a danger to children”.
